Itinerary

  1. Day 1

    Paris

    You'll arrive at Paris CDG or Orly airport where pickup is arranged based on your flight time. After getting settled at your hotel, you'll take a River Seine cruise on a glass canopy boat to see the Parisian boulevards from the water. Then it's off to the Eiffel Tower summit with skip-the-line tickets so you can go straight up. Depending on when you arrive, some activities might shift to the next couple of days.

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• River Seine Cruise - glass canopy boat tour
    • Eiffel Tower summit visit - skip-the-line entry
    Landmarks/POIs
    Eiffel Tower
    River Seine
  2. Day 2

    Paris

    Start the day with a guided walking tour around Paris where your local guide will show you Notre-Dame Cathedral, Pont Neuf, and other iconic spots. After lunch, head to the Louvre Museum with skip-the-line tickets. You'll have the rest of the day to explore at your own pace and see what interests you most before the museum closes.

  4. Day 4

    Paris to Dijon

    Take the train from Paris to Dijon this morning with your ticket provided. From the train station, you'll arrange your own way to the hotel using a taxi, tram, or metro. Once you're checked in, spend the rest of the afternoon and evening getting familiar with Dijon at your own pace.

    Meals
    Breakfast
  5. Day 5

    Dijon

    Explore Dijon on your own today. Wander around the medieval half-timbered streets, visit the Palace of the Dukes of Burgundy where the Musée des Beaux-Arts is located, and see Place de la Libération and the cathedral. Look for the bronze owl symbols marking the 'Owl Trail' that leads to important landmarks around town. Check out the local gardens and try some of the city's famous mustard.

  6. Day 6

    Dijon to Lyon

    Take the train from Dijon to Lyon with your ticket included. Arrange your transfer from the station on your own using taxi, tram, or metro. After settling in, explore Lyon's historic neighborhoods starting with Vieux Lyon, then the Presqu'île district, and finishing at Fourvière Hill, all part of the UNESCO World Heritage sites.

  7. Day 7

    Annecy (Day trip from Lyon)

    Head out on a day trip to Annecy, known as the Venice of the Alps. Spend time in the Old Town walking along the canals past colorful medieval houses. Visit Lake Annecy, one of Europe's cleanest lakes, and walk out to the Palais de l'Isle for photos. Climb up to Château d'Annecy for views over the whole area. Your return train ticket gets you back to Lyon by evening.

  8. Day 8

    Lyon to Avignon

    Take the train from Lyon to Avignon with your ticket provided. Arrange your own transfer to your hotel. After settling in, explore the walled old town checking out the Popes' Palace, Avignon Cathedral with its gilded Virgin Mary statue, and the Doms Rock Gardens. Walk through Clock Square, visit the Market Halls, and end at the historic Bridge St Benezet before dark.

  9. Day 9

    Nîmes (Day trip from Avignon)

    Catch the train to Nîmes this morning, about a 30 minute trip with your ticket included. Explore the city's Roman heritage starting with the UNESCO-listed Maison Carrée temple from 2 AD and the well-preserved arena. Grab lunch at Les Halles de Nimes, then stroll through Les Jardins de la Fontaine before heading back to Avignon by train.

  • Kelly
    · July 13th, 2025
    We had a good trip to Paris and Switzerland! The planners from TourRadar at WiseYatra were very communicative leading up to the trip via WhatsApp. I appreciated how knowledgeable the representative was about the places we were going. On the video call, he reviewed the itinerary in detail, even walked me through the train system as a first-timer, and spent as much times as I needed to answer my questions. They were willing to work with me to adjust the original itinerary to fit in my preferences for things I wanted to be sure to see. The itinerary they planned had plenty for us to do and had each day packed! They booked the hotels, skip the line tickets, and some of the main transportation for us (not including taxis, Ubers, or Paris Metro). The chosen hotels were fair but not great and not in ideal location to sightseeing, however convenient to a train station. Overall a great trip and would recommend.
